Eco-Friendly Pest Control Data and Sustainable Solutions

 

The Eco-Friendly Pest Control Data provides an insightful look into the current trends, innovations, and challenges within the industry, emphasizing the shift towards sustainable solutions and practices. With increasing environmental awareness, there’s been a significant movement towards adopting eco-friendly pest control methods.

Adoption and Benefits highlight crucial trends where Integrated Pest Management (IPM) has led to a 50% reduction in pesticide use. This approach combines biological, cultural, physical, and chemical tools in a way that minimizes economic, health, and environmental risks. The data also reveals that 80% of consumers prefer eco-friendly options, indicating strong market demand for sustainable practices.

  • Technological Innovations: The sector is evolving with eco-friendly pesticides infused with essential oils and the integration of IoT for real-time monitoring. These technologies enhance efficacy and safety, providing users with precise and timely pest control solutions.
  • Genetic Research: There is growing interest in biocontrol methods, which involve using natural predators or genetically modified organisms to manage pest populations. These methods offer sustainable alternatives to traditional chemical pesticides.

Challenges and Community Involvement address the obstacles faced by the industry. The complexity of regulatory frameworks often hinders innovation, as companies navigate varying standards and approvals. Additionally, the cost of eco-friendly products can be a barrier for both providers and consumers, though it is expected to decrease as technologies become more mainstream.

  • Community and Education: Increasing public awareness and developing effective consumer engagement strategies are crucial for widespread adoption. Education campaigns can help illustrate the benefits of eco-friendly pest control, encouraging more consumers and businesses to make informed choices.

Overall, the data underscores a promising trend towards sustainable pest control and organic pest control, driven by consumer preferences and technological advancements.

Effects of Traditional Pest Control Methods on the Environment

Effects of Traditional Pest Control Methods on the Environment

Traditional pest control methods that rely on chemical pesticides and other hazardous substances pose significant threats to the environment and can adversely affect insect populations, including beneficial species that are crucial for maintaining ecological balance and natural remedies.

These pesticides can harm target insect species and disrupt entire ecosystems, leading to a decline in pollinators such as bees and butterflies. The consequences of reduced insect diversity can be severe, as insects play vital roles in pollination, nutrient recycling, and serving as a food source for various wildlife species.

The ongoing reliance on chemical pest management has resulted in a concerning increase in pesticide resistance among harmful pests, exacerbating the issue and creating a cycle of escalating chemical use and pest problems.

This toxic cycle poses a long-term threat to human health, not only through residues in our food and water but also by disrupting fragile ecosystems that rely on healthy populations of both harmful and beneficial organisms.

Types of Bug Zappers and Their Effectiveness

Types of Bug Zappers and Their Effectiveness

Bug zappers come in various types, each offering distinct benefits and varying levels of effectiveness against different insect populations, particularly troublesome pests like mosquitoes and flies.

These devices are available in a range of designs, from basic electric grid models, solar powered to more advanced UV light traps that use attractants to lure insects. Their functionality also varies; some units are specifically designed to attract mosquitoes by utilizing carbon dioxide or pheromones, while others target a broader range of flying insects.

For those seeking non-lethal methods to address pest issues without resorting to chemical pesticides, bug zappers and natural pest control methods offer environmentally friendly solutions.

Common use cases include patios, backyards, and campsites, where the annoying presence of insects and mosquito populations can detract from the outdoor experience.
